首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过Python连接到MySQL,我得到了相互矛盾的结果

通过Python连接到MySQL,相互矛盾的结果可能是由以下原因引起的:

  1. 数据库连接配置错误:首先,需要确保在Python代码中正确配置了数据库连接参数,包括主机名、端口号、用户名、密码和数据库名称。检查这些参数是否正确设置,并且确保能够成功连接到MySQL数据库。
  2. SQL语句错误:如果使用了不正确的SQL语句,可能会导致相互矛盾的结果。请仔细检查SQL语句的语法和逻辑,确保其正确性。可以使用MySQL的官方文档或者其他相关的学习资源来查阅正确的SQL语法和用法。
  3. 数据库中数据不一致:如果相互矛盾的结果是由于数据不一致引起的,可能是因为在操作数据的过程中出现了错误或者数据更新不同步。可以使用事务管理来确保数据的一致性,或者进行必要的数据同步操作。
  4. 数据库版本兼容性问题:不同版本的MySQL数据库可能存在一些兼容性问题,导致在连接或执行SQL语句时产生相互矛盾的结果。建议使用最新版本的MySQL数据库,并确保使用的Python库与MySQL数据库版本兼容。

推荐腾讯云相关产品:腾讯云数据库MySQL

腾讯云数据库MySQL是腾讯云提供的一种关系型数据库服务,适用于各种规模的业务场景。它提供了高可用性、高性能、高安全性的数据库解决方案,并支持灵活的扩展和强大的管理功能。

产品介绍链接地址:https://cloud.tencent.com/product/cdb

腾讯云数据库MySQL的优势:

  • 高可用性:腾讯云数据库MySQL提供了主备复制和自动故障切换功能,确保数据库的高可用性和数据的持久性。
  • 高性能:腾讯云数据库MySQL采用了优化的数据库引擎和硬件设施,提供了卓越的性能和响应能力。
  • 高安全性:腾讯云数据库MySQL支持数据加密、访问控制、网络隔离等安全机制,确保数据的安全性和隐私保护。
  • 灵活扩展:腾讯云数据库MySQL支持弹性扩容和自动容量调整,可以根据业务需求灵活扩展数据库的容量和性能。

腾讯云数据库MySQL适用的场景:

  • Web应用程序:腾讯云数据库MySQL适用于各种Web应用程序,提供可靠的数据库存储和高性能的访问能力。
  • 数据分析:腾讯云数据库MySQL支持复杂的数据查询和分析功能,适用于大规模数据分析和挖掘。
  • 企业应用:腾讯云数据库MySQL可以作为企业应用的后端数据库,提供稳定、安全的数据存储和访问能力。

请注意,以上推荐的腾讯云产品和链接地址仅供参考,具体选择还需根据实际需求进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券